What's a Volume Sales Representative?
Volume Sales Representatives at Rally focus on the small and medium
sized customers. This is an important segment of our business. Lead
flow is significant and the successful rep will know how to quickly
qualify opportunities and move the deal forward.

Agile Development Coach - London, U.K.

Rally is a dynamic, start-up that provides software-driven enterprises
a complete solution of knowledge, coaching and tooling to succeed with
Agile, the next generation of software development practices. We are
recognized nationally as the best product in our category (Jolt Award
2006 - 2008), locally as the most innovative product (IQ Awards) and
as a top "Best company to work for in Colorado" 2006 - 2008.

Due to our success, we are seeking an experienced and motivated Agile
Development Consultant and Coach to join Rally's London based office.

An ideal candidate has experience and interest in extending skills in
the following areas.

Qualifications

· Prior experience coaching Agile project teams with methods such as
Scrum, XP, Lean, FDD, DSDM, or Crystal.

· Prior Consulting background - you will be working with multiple
clients through on site collaboration and remote support.

· Experience leading consulting engagements.

· Training experience - we develop our own collateral in close
partnership with leading experts in the agile community and deliver
training to customer teams.

· Solution selling experience.

· Experience in leading technical teams - coaching, teaching and
guiding people in the various roles in a project driven organization.

· Facilitation skills in leading planning meetings, reviews, and
retrospectives.

· Excellent presentation skills - we value and encourage public
speaking engagements and expect that you're comfortable talking to
teams from engineering level upwards.

· Strong knowledge and passion about Agile principles and practices-
we expect that you have a solid grounding and we will support you
extending your knowledge through challenging work, investment in
training, and constant association with our Agile experts.

· Willingness to travel 50% - we're a company that is expanding within
EMEA and beyond.

· 10 years or more experience in technology/software organizations.

· Certified ScrumMaster (Practitioner or Trainer) required.
